Your nutrients are bottomed out so your corals are starving to death. They decline from the inside out so it can take weeks or months for the decline to be visible.
 

Check for stray voltage with volt meter. If you find a piece of equipment giving a high reading that can indicate faulty equipment that might be leaching metals into your tank. (copper etc.) Follow up with ICP
